XII. Trace the glass bead If you are wondering where the glass comes from, the northern part of the Czech Republic is the answer. In Jablonec nad Nisou, there is a Muzeum of glass and jewelry. Next to the museum, there is a gallery called Palace Plus where you can buy a traditional glass present…

XV. Romantic tour Palackého stezkou The starting point for our trip is railway station Jesenný. Together we will follow the river Kamenice and continue to the village named Bozkov. You can enjoy the view from the tower of the church – kostel Navštívení Panny Marie. Nearby, there are unique caves called Bozkovské jeskyně, make sure…

For the delicacies of the Bohemian Paradise Firstly, it is necessary to mention that in Lomnice nad Popelkou one could spend even a day, there is so much to see – the castle, historic centre, or famous monument area Karlov! In case you have never tasted lomnické suchary, the traditional speciality, we recommend you…
